hi folks, i found this board not too long ago and can easily say it has been one of the most helpful things for me.  i've been devouring the wealth of information and have already started my own transition plan.  thanks to the info here, the first thing i did was get a gender therapist and this is helping immensely.  today i just finished up epilating my legs and some of my chest and (poorly) shaving the groin for the first time.  i'm only out to my therapist and now to you all.  im still dreading the talk with the spouse and kid.  thanks for all the info and conversations you all have posted.  i only have a  couple questions.  are you still obsessed with your gender?  i can't stop thinking about gender and what will be and, while it is nice to fantasize, i hope at least the constant drum beat of gender slows down a bit.  second, does the self-doubt every stop for you?  thanks again, khati

Obsessed with gender?  Dan is and thinks about it constantly.  Denise never thinks about it.

It's the strangest thing.  When I present as Denise the constant "pounding" isn't there.  I feel comfortable and totally at ease. 
Dan has constant pressure to be "alpha" or always in control.  Denise doesn't have any of that and the gender monster is gone.

However and this is important, most of the anger of my Dysphoria went away with the Spiro in about 3 days from starting it.
